THE LOOKING GLASS: Poetry, by Kamala Das

THE LOOKING GLASS

Getting a man to love you is easy, only be honest about your wants as woman. Stand nude before the glass with him, so that he sees himself the stronger one, and believes it so, and you so much more, softer, younger, lovelier. Admit your admiration. Notice the perfection of his limbs, his eyes reddening under the shower, the shy walk across the bathroom floor, dropping towels, and the jerky way he hrinates. All the fond details that make, him male and your only man. Gift him all, gift him what makes you woman, the scent of long hair, the musk of sweat between the breasts, the warm shock of menstrual blood, and all your endless female hungers. Oh yes, getting a man to love is easy, but living, without him afterwards may have to be faced. A living without life when you move around, meeting strangers, with your eyes that gave up their search, with ears that hear only, his last voice calling out your name and your body which once under his touch had gleamed, like burnished brass, now drab and destitute.

(Kamala Das)
